Family-friendly hotel with 3 outdoor pools and 3 spa tubs This smoke-free hotel features 3 outdoor pools, a golf course, and a restaurant. WiFi in public areas is free. Additionally, a 24-hour fitness center, a bar/lounge, and a 24-hour business center are onsite. Hyatt Regency Newport Beach offers 407 accommodations with iPod docking stations and laptop-compatible safes. Pillowtop beds feature down comforters. Flat-screen televisions come with premium cable channels and pay movies. Guests can make use of the in-room refrigerators and coffee/tea makers. Bathrooms include shower/tub combinations, complimentary toiletries, and hair dryers. Guests can surf the web using the complimentary wired and wireless Internet access. Business-friendly amenities include desks, desk chairs, and phones. Additionally, rooms include complimentary weekday newspapers and irons/ironing boards. Microwaves and hypo-allergenic bedding can be requested. Housekeeping is provided daily. Guests can play rounds at the 9-hole golf course and enjoy other recreation facilities including complimentary bicycles. 3 outdoor swimming pools and 3 spa tubs are on site. In addition to a children's pool, other recreational amenities include a waterslide and a 24-hour fitness center.
